V/A - The Paths Of Pain (The CAIFE Label, Quito, 1960-68) DLP Fanzines took a turn towards goth-inflectedHonest Jons presents The Paths Of Pain The CAIFE Label, Quito, 1960 68, a loving exploration of Ecuadors musica national as it existed before other international musical strains began to mingle with the sound and push it along to different stratospheres. Packaged with lovingly assembled liner notes and images, theres two dozen tracks from the likes of Lucho Munoz, Biluka and Los Inaquingas plus many more.
